How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 02121?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| 02121 Studio Apartments | $2,239 | $1,500 | $3,240 |
| 02121 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,186 | $890 | $3,500 |
| 02121 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,901 | $2,062 | $10,997 |
| 02121 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,259 | $890 | $7,871 |
| 02121 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,063 | $2,995 | $6,800 |
| 02121 5 Bedroom Apartments | $4,759 | $4,200 | $5,500 |
